FreeBSD Bugzilla – Attachment 162095 Details for
Bug 203767
[patch] devel/thrift{-cpp,-c_glib}: Update to 0.9.3, extra patches
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
patch thrift ports
patch-thrift-0.9.3.diff (text/plain), 5.32 KB, created by
David Carlier
on 2015-10-15 19:19:26 UTC
(
hide
)
Description:
patch thrift ports
Filename:
MIME Type:
Creator:
David Carlier
Created:
2015-10-15 19:19:26 UTC
Size:
5.32 KB
patch
obsolete
>Index: thrift/Makefile >=================================================================== >--- thrift/Makefile (revision 399358) >+++ thrift/Makefile (working copy) >@@ -43,7 +43,8 @@ > --without-php \ > --without-php_extension \ > --without-python \ >- --without-ruby >+ --without-ruby \ >+ --without-go > > PLIST_FILES= bin/thrift > >Index: thrift/bsd.thrift.mk >=================================================================== >--- thrift/bsd.thrift.mk (revision 399358) >+++ thrift/bsd.thrift.mk (working copy) >@@ -5,7 +5,7 @@ > # in your makefile, set: > # PORTVERSION= ${THRIFT_PORTVERSION} > # see $PORTSDIR/devel/thrift for examples >-THRIFT_PORTVERSION= 0.9.1 >+THRIFT_PORTVERSION= 0.9.3 > THRIFT_PORTREVISION= 1 > > CONFIGURE_ARGS+= \ >Index: thrift/distinfo >=================================================================== >--- thrift/distinfo (revision 399358) >+++ thrift/distinfo (working copy) >@@ -1,2 +1,2 @@ >-SHA256 (thrift-0.9.1.tar.gz) = ac175080c8cac567b0331e394f23ac306472c071628396db2850cb00c41b0017 >-SIZE (thrift-0.9.1.tar.gz) = 3402353 >+SHA256 (thrift-0.9.3.tar.gz) = b0740a070ac09adde04d43e852ce4c320564a292f26521c46b78e0641564969e >+SIZE (thrift-0.9.3.tar.gz) = 8897936 >Index: thrift-c_glib/Makefile >=================================================================== >--- thrift-c_glib/Makefile (revision 399358) >+++ thrift-c_glib/Makefile (working copy) >@@ -40,7 +40,8 @@ > --without-php \ > --without-php_extension \ > --without-python \ >- --without-ruby >+ --without-ruby \ >+ --without-go > > post-patch: > @${REINPLACE_CMD} 's,^pkgconfigdir = .*,pkgconfigdir=$${prefix}/libdata/pkgconfig,' ${WRKSRC}/lib/c_glib/Makefile.am >Index: thrift-cpp/Makefile >=================================================================== >--- thrift-cpp/Makefile (revision 399358) >+++ thrift-cpp/Makefile (working copy) >@@ -23,8 +23,6 @@ > USE_LDCONFIG= yes > MAKE_JOBS_UNSAFE= yes > PLIST_SUB= PORTVERSION="${THRIFT_PORTVERSION}" >-BUILD_WRKSRC= ${WRKSRC}/lib/cpp >-INSTALL_WRKSRC= ${WRKSRC}/lib/cpp > > OPTIONS_DEFINE= QT4 > QT4_CONFIGURE_WITH= qt4 >@@ -43,7 +41,8 @@ > --without-php \ > --without-php_extension \ > --without-python \ >- --without-ruby >+ --without-ruby \ >+ --without-go > > .include <bsd.port.pre.mk> > >Index: thrift-cpp/files/patch-lib__cpp__src__thrift__protocol__TBinaryProtocol.tcc >=================================================================== >--- thrift-cpp/files/patch-lib__cpp__src__thrift__protocol__TBinaryProtocol.tcc (revision 399358) >+++ thrift-cpp/files/patch-lib__cpp__src__thrift__protocol__TBinaryProtocol.tcc (working copy) >@@ -1,11 +1,11 @@ >---- ./lib/cpp/src/thrift/protocol/TBinaryProtocol.tcc.orig 2013-08-15 18:04:29.000000000 +0400 >-+++ ./lib/cpp/src/thrift/protocol/TBinaryProtocol.tcc 2013-10-16 01:15:53.000000000 +0400 >-@@ -23,7 +23,7 @@ >- #include <thrift/protocol/TBinaryProtocol.h> >+--- lib/cpp/src/thrift/protocol/TBinaryProtocol.tcc.orig 2015-10-13 19:19:23 UTC >++++ lib/cpp/src/thrift/protocol/TBinaryProtocol.tcc >+@@ -24,6 +24,8 @@ > > #include <limits> >-- >+ > +#include <netinet/in.h> >- >- namespace apache { namespace thrift { namespace protocol { >- >++ >+ namespace apache { >+ namespace thrift { >+ namespace protocol { >Index: thrift-cpp/files/patch-lib__cpp__src__thrift__server__TNonblockingServer.h >=================================================================== >--- thrift-cpp/files/patch-lib__cpp__src__thrift__server__TNonblockingServer.h (revision 399358) >+++ thrift-cpp/files/patch-lib__cpp__src__thrift__server__TNonblockingServer.h (working copy) >@@ -1,12 +1,12 @@ >---- ./lib/cpp/src/thrift/server/TNonblockingServer.h.orig 2013-08-15 18:04:29.000000000 +0400 >-+++ ./lib/cpp/src/thrift/server/TNonblockingServer.h 2013-10-16 01:15:53.000000000 +0400 >-@@ -38,7 +38,8 @@ >- #include <unistd.h> >- #endif >- #include <event.h> >-- >+--- lib/cpp/src/thrift/server/TNonblockingServer.h.orig 2015-10-13 19:19:36 UTC >++++ lib/cpp/src/thrift/server/TNonblockingServer.h >+@@ -41,6 +41,9 @@ >+ #include <event2/event_compat.h> >+ #include <event2/event_struct.h> >+ > +#include <sys/types.h> > +#include <sys/socket.h> >- >- >- namespace apache { namespace thrift { namespace server { >++ >+ namespace apache { >+ namespace thrift { >+ namespace server { >Index: thrift-cpp/pkg-plist >=================================================================== >--- thrift-cpp/pkg-plist (revision 399358) >+++ thrift-cpp/pkg-plist (working copy) >@@ -2,7 +2,6 @@ > include/thrift/TDispatchProcessor.h > include/thrift/TLogging.h > include/thrift/TProcessor.h >-include/thrift/TReflectionLocal.h > include/thrift/Thrift.h > include/thrift/async/TAsyncBufferProcessor.h > include/thrift/async/TAsyncChannel.h >@@ -37,7 +36,6 @@ > include/thrift/protocol/TCompactProtocol.h > include/thrift/protocol/TCompactProtocol.tcc > include/thrift/protocol/TDebugProtocol.h >-include/thrift/protocol/TDenseProtocol.h > include/thrift/protocol/TJSONProtocol.h > include/thrift/protocol/TMultiplexedProtocol.h > include/thrift/protocol/TProtocol.h >@@ -75,7 +73,7 @@ > include/thrift/transport/TTransportUtils.h > include/thrift/transport/TVirtualTransport.h > include/thrift/transport/TZlibTransport.h >-lib/libthrift-0.9.1.so >+lib/libthrift-0.9.3.so > lib/libthrift.a > lib/libthrift.so > lib/libthrift.so.0 >@@ -87,7 +85,7 @@ > %%QT4%%lib/libthriftqt.a > %%QT4%%lib/libthriftqt.so > %%QT4%%lib/libthriftqt.so.0 >-lib/libthriftz-0.9.1.so >+lib/libthriftz-0.9.3.so > lib/libthriftz.a > lib/libthriftz.so > lib/libthriftz.so.0
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Flags:
koobs
:
maintainer-approval+
Actions:
View
|
Diff
Attachments on
bug 203767
:
162026
| 162095 |
162097